title = "Preparation of graded-index plastic optical fiber by co-extrusion process",
abstract = "A novel fabrication method of graded index polymer optical fibers (GI-POFs) called the {"}co-extrusion process{"} is proposed and demonstrated for first time. This continuous fabrication process can reduce the fabrication cost of GI-POFs. Dopant diffusion temperature, dopant diffusion time, and the molecular weight of PMMA were optimized. By this optimization, desirable refractive index profile was achieved. Therefore, it is exhibited that the GI-POF obtained by the co-extrusion process has as high bandwidth as the one prepared by the conventional interfacial-gel polymerization process.",
